mirror of
https://github.com/wasrusgen/zov-tech.git
synced 2026-06-03 21:04:49 +00:00
По аналогии с пиктограммами категорий техники добавил инструктивные рисунки к чек-листу замера. Walnut stroke + cream fill + лёгкая тень. 1. topview — вид сверху, комната с пронумерованными стенами + компас. 2. clockwise — стрелка по часовой стрелке с точкой «старт». 3. openings — фронт стены с дверью / окном / балконом + размеры (ширина, высота, низ подоконника). 4. comms — стена с точками R1 / Sw1 / Wc1, двумя размерами на каждую (горизонталь до угла-базы + вертикаль до пола), указанная БАЗА: ПУ. 5. levels — разрез помещения с нулевым полом (волнистая стяжка), плитой +88, потолком и коробом справа, размеры H1/H2. Реализация: - Новый файл miniapp/assets/zamer-picts.js — экспортирует ZAMER_PICTS. - renderMarkdown в measurements.js поддерживает директиву «@pict:KEY» на отдельной строке → подставляет SVG. - Эскизы вставлены в ЧЕКЛИСТ_ЗАМЕРА.md в соответствующие разделы (1, 4, 6, 8). По часовой стрелке — после § 1. - CSS .cl-pict — рамка пунктиром + цент., max-height 220. Cache bust v=20260513x.
8.1 KiB
8.1 KiB
Чек-лист замера квартиры
Применяется ко всем фото-замерам. Цель — чтобы по фото без уточнений собирался корректный CAD/DXF и менеджер всё понял с первого взгляда.
1. Перед началом — вид сверху и порядок
@pict:topview
- Завести папку
ЗАМЕРЫ/<номер> <адрес> - <кв>/(как 157, 158…). - Снимать каждую стену отдельно, кадр должен охватывать стену целиком, от пола до потолка.
- Имя файла фото = номер стены:
<N>_w1.jpg,<N>_w2.jpg, … (либо переименовать после съёмки). - Стены нумеруются по часовой стрелке от первого угла.
@pict:clockwise
2. На каждой стене — обязательный минимум
2.1. Габариты
- Ширина по верху (от ЛУ до ПУ).
- Ширина по низу.
- При необходимости — ширина по середине (если стена «играет»).
- Высота слева (от пола до потолка).
- Высота справа.
2.2. Углы
- Угол в ЛВ (левый-верх): значение в градусах, например
89,9°. - Угол в ПВ (правый-верх).
- Угол в ЛН (левый-низ).
- Угол в ПН (правый-низ).
- Если угол не мерил — пиши
≈90°, чтобы потом не угадывали.
2.3. База отсчёта
- Выбрать один угол для всех горизонтальных размеров на этой стене (обычно — общий физический угол со смежной стеной).
- Подписать в кадре:
БАЗА: ЛУилиБАЗА: ПУ. - Все горизонтали на этой стене — только от этой базы. Никаких цепочек между точками.
2.4. Вертикальная база
- Низ —
пол(нулевой пол, обычно +88 мм над плитой). - Верх —
потолок. - Для каждой точки — указать, от пола или от потолка считаешь Y.
3. Точки замера — формат пина
Каждая точка = крест/кружок на стене + шильд со стрелкой. В шильде только код:
| Код | Что это |
|---|---|
R1, R2, … |
розетка одинарная |
R1×2, R1×3 |
блок из 2/3 розеток в одной точке |
Rs1 |
силовая розетка |
Sw1 |
выключатель |
Ld1 |
светильник (LED, бра, потолочный) |
V1 |
вентиляция / вентбокс (+ габарит, например 200×200) |
J1 |
распаечная коробка |
Wc1 |
вода холодная |
Wh1 |
вода горячая |
D1 |
слив / канализация (горизонт. выход) |
D1' |
фановый/вертикальный выход у того же узла |
Tv1 |
ТВ |
Net1 |
интернет |
Не писать «роз x1» — только код.
4. Размеры на каждой точке — два числа
@pict:comms
- Горизонталь до угла-базы: число + (по желанию) буква базы, например
1087→ПУ. - Вертикаль до пола или потолка:
617↑полили1919↓потолок.
Не давать цепочек между точками. Если одна горизонталь общая для нескольких точек (R6/Wc1/Wh1 на 617) — пиши число один раз, а напротив каждой точки — её X.
5. Объёмные элементы (выпуски, ниши, колонны)
Развёртка плоская, глубина не показывается. Пиши в шильд так:
- Труба торчит из стены:
D1' выпуск 70— значит выходит на 70 мм от плоскости стены. Стрелка от точки — косая. - Ниша:
ниша 100×400 гл.50. - Колонна / выступ:
колонна +120(выступает на 120 мм).
6. Проёмы (двери / окна / балкон)
@pict:openings
- Обвести проём прямоугольником с диагональю.
- Подписать код:
ДВ1,ОК1,БК1. - Размеры:
- ширина проёма
- высота проёма (от пола)
- отступ от угла-базы стены до края проёма
- для окна — высота низа подоконника от пола
7. Стена «без элементов»
- Только габариты + углы.
- Подписать
пустоили просто не ставить точки.
8. Общая информация (один раз на квартиру) — перепады и нулевой пол
@pict:levels
- Номер замера.
- Адрес, корпус, квартира.
- Дата замера.
- Толщина стяжки / нулевой пол (например,
0,000 = +88 мм над плитой, стяжка 98 мм). - Зафиксировать перепады пола (волнистость стяжки) — если есть существенные, отметить в углах помещения отдельными размерами.
- Зафиксировать перепады потолка — балки, короба, понижения. Подписать H1/H2/... в нужных зонах.
- План комнаты со стрелками-направлениями: какая стена 1/2/3/4 (особенно когда несколько помещений).
- Если стены смежные — отметить общий угол: «ПУ стены 2 = ЛУ стены 3».
9. Перед отправкой
- Проверить, что для каждой точки указаны и горизонталь, и вертикаль.
- Проверить, что все горизонтали на одной стене считаны от одного угла-базы.
- Отметить базы прямо на фото (
БАЗА: ПУ). - Углы в градусах подписаны (или пометка
≈90°). - Сложить все фото в папку замера.
10. Что я делаю с фото
- Кладу всё в
<папка замера>/CAD/. - Создаю DXF (R2018, мм) с тремя/четырьмя развёртками стен.
- Каждая точка = крест + код в шильде + два размера до баз.
- PNG и PDF превью для отправки менеджеру.
- Скрипт
build_cad.pyостаётся в той же папке — можно править координаты и пересобирать.
Пример (замер 157, кв. 411)
- Стена 1: пусто, только габариты (1149×2745).
- Стена 2: база — ПРАВЫЙ угол. R7, R5, R6, Wc1, Wh1, D1, D1', R8.
- Стена 3: база — ЛЕВЫЙ угол. V1, R4, Ld1, R1×2, Rs5, R3.
- ПУ стены 2 = ЛУ стены 3 (общий физический угол).